About the Role

We are seeking a highly skilled and motivated Senior Electrical Engineer to join the Anthro Design Team. The ideal candidate will have experience in rail station electrical services design and coordination.

As a Senior Electrical Engineer you will review and produce electrical designs, and this may involve assuming a DPE role. We are looking for someone who’s dedicated, diligent, and driven, and will take this challenge head on, being an important part of a dynamic team with big ambitions.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Undertaking the CRE role, with/without mentoring
  • Prepare and monitor technical submittals for approval by the client
  • Responsibility for producing electrical designs to project requirements
  • Develop design from feasibility up to As Built
  • Production of design proposals (e.g. sketches) for agreement with the client, stakeholders, subcontractors, suppliers etc.
  • Writing project communications such as Requests For Information (RFIs) & meeting minutes
  • Maintaining trackers, registers and schedules
  • Carrying out design reviews and working to design assurance processes
  • Support and help develop less experienced members of the team
  • Nurture a get it right first time culture within the team

What do we need from you

  • Electrical Engineering qualification and a minimum of 10 years professional experience
  • Experience in rail station electrical services design and coordination
  • Experience of working in an engineering production environment
  • Experience of multi-disciplinary design and coordination, and the delivery of projects to a high quality, throughout all design stages
  • Experience of working with 3D models in a BIM environment
  • Experience of producing technical notes, reports, specifications, drawings, schedules and calculations
  • Ability to find solutions to engineering problems
  • Capable of managing design interfaces and integration processes
  • Good knowledge of British Standards and Regulations, and Rail Standards, such as Network Rail, HS2 and TfL
  • Understanding of project scopes, requirements, works information, and commercial awareness
  • Ability to deliver work to a programme and budget
  • Strong communication and collaboration abilities
  • Capable of working as part of a team and on own initiative
  • Comfortable leading meetings and presenting to clients, stakeholders, colleagues, subcontractors, suppliers etc.
  • Excellent understanding of electrical systems from a technical, design, installation, buildability, and maintainability perspective
  • Proficient in engineering software tools including Trimble/Amtech Pro Design, Dialux or Relux
  • Awareness of procurement activities and lead times
  • Being committed to professional development, staying updated on industry trends, best practices, and emerging technologies in rail design and engineering, integrating them into project designs as appropriate
